Across its line, Lexus runs self-charging hybrid systems that pair a petrol engine with electric drive and recover energy under braking, with no plug-in requirement. The LM 350h applies this in flagship form: a 2.5-litre four-cylinder petrol engine and a dual-motor E-Four all-wheel-drive architecture for a combined 250 PS (184 kW), driving through an electronic continuously variable transmission (e-CVT). The LM 350h sits at the top of the Lexus hierarchy and defines what the marque means by a rear-passenger flagship. Its 4-seater VIP compartment carries a 48-inch ultra-widescreen monitor in the centre partition, above a glass screen with electronic dimming and a motorised privacy elevator. A 23-speaker Mark Levinson Reference 3D Surround Sound system, a 14-litre refrigerator, and the Climate Concierge sensor array equip the cabin. Motorised reclining captain’s chairs occupy the rear, with seat heating, ventilation, and pneumatic massage on both positions. Lexus engineers its luxury models for ride isolation over outright pace. The LM 350h carries Adaptive Variable Suspension (AVS) with a dedicated Rear Comfort drive mode that prioritises rear-passenger ride quality over dynamic response.
